WebAugust von Kotzebue (1761 - 1819), German dramatist and writer who also worked as a Russian Consul General. His assassination served as a justification of the Carlsbad Decrees. Woodcut engraving after a painting (1809) by Johann Heinrich Wilhelm Tischbein (German painter, 1751 - 1829), published in 1882. Web20 mar 2024 · Dramatism is a metaphor introduced by 20th-century rhetorician Kenneth Burke to describe his critical method, which includes study of the various relations among the five qualities that comprise the pentad: act, scene, agent, agency, and purpose. Adjective: dramatistic. Also known as the dramatistic method. Often ranked second only to Shakespeare among Jacobean tragedians, Webster is the author of two major works, The White Devil (1612) and The Duchess of Malfi (1614), which are more frequently revived on stage than any plays of the period other than Shakespeare's.
